
#porta h1 {font-size: 45px;line-height: 50px;padding-bottom: 20px;padding-right: 30px;}
#porta h4 {font-size: 25px;line-height: 30px;padding-bottom: 30px;}
#porta p {font-size: 16px;line-height: 22px;padding-bottom: 20px;}

#porta .callout-0 {background:#fff;padding: 150px 0 20px;overflow: hidden;}
#porta .callout-0 h2{ padding: 0 50px;}
#porta .callout-0 .medium-6{padding-bottom:20px;}
#porta .callout-0 .breve_detalle {padding-top:20px;}
#porta .callout-0 .sombreado {color:#fff;padding:7px 12px;position:absolute;left:0;right:0;margin:auto!important;bottom:0;max-width:800px;width: 100%;height: 100%; /*background: linear-gradient(to bottom, transparent 75%, #333 100%);background:url(../img/degrade.png);*/}

#porta .callout-0  ._sombra._sombra_izq{right: inherit;left:-250px;top: 160px;}
#porta .callout-0  ._sombra._sombra_derecha{right: -280px;top: 160px;}
#porta .callout-0  ._sombra._sombra_bottom{bottom: -260px;left:90px;}

#porta .callout-1  ._sombra._sombra_izq{right: inherit;left:-350px;top: -460px;}
#porta .callout-1   ._sombra._sombra_derecha{right: -280px;bottom: 360px;}

#porta .callout-11 {background:#fff;padding-bottom: 60px;}
#porta .callout-11 ._problematica {padding-bottom:50px ;}
#porta .callout-11 ._problematica p{max-width: 400px;margin: 0 auto;}
#porta .callout-11 ._receta h4 {padding-TOP:50px ;}

#porta .callout-slider{padding: 50px 0 90px;overflow: hidden;}
#porta .callout-slider h4{padding: 0px 0 50px;}
#porta .callout-slider  ._sombra._sombra_izq{right: inherit;left:-250px;top: 160px;}
#porta .callout-slider  ._sombra._sombra_derecha{right: -280px;top:160px;}

#porta .lSSlideOuter .lSPager.lSpg {top: 80%;}


#porta .callout-1{background:#fff;padding:10px 0 10px;}
#porta .callout-1 figure img{width:auto;}
#porta .callout-1 h4 {color:#fff;padding:7px 12px;border-radius:20px;position:absolute;left:0;right:0;margin:auto!important;bottom:40%;max-width:800px;}
#porta .callout-1 figure img{ border-radius:50PX ; -webkit-border-radius:50PX ; -moz-border-radius:50PX ; -ms-border-radius:50PX ; -o-border-radius:50PX ; }




/* old */
#porta .callout-3{background:#22385A;padding:60px 0 ;}
#porta .callout-3 h2{font-size:65px;line-height:75px;padding-bottom:30px;padding-right:30px;padding-top:70px;}
#porta .callout-3 h2 span{display:block;}
#porta .callout-3 p{font-size:16px;line-height:21px;padding-bottom:80px;}


@media  screen and (max-width: 800px){
	#porta .callout-0 h4{left:20px;text-align: left;}
	#porta h1 {padding-right: 00px;}
}

@media  screen and (max-width: 40em){
	#porta .callout-1{padding:30px 0;}
	#porta .callout-1 h2{font-size: 35px;line-height: 55px}
	#porta .callout-1 h4{top:30px;font-size:18px;line-height:25px;}	
	#porta .callout-1 .medium-6{padding-bottom: 30px;}
	#porta .callout-3{padding:20px 0;}
	#porta .callout-3 h2{font-size: 35px;line-height: 45px;}

	#porta .callout-0 {background: #fff;padding: 20px 0 20px;}

	#porta .callout-0 {padding: 60px 0 0px;}
	#porta .callout-11 ._receta h4 {padding-TOP: 0;}
	#porta .callout-11 {padding-bottom: 20px;	}
	#porta h1{padding-bottom: 0;}

}

@media  screen and (max-width: 380px){
	#porta .callout-3 h2{font-size:25px;line-height:35px;}
}